Ancelotti Gives Neymar Two Months To Prove Fitness For Brazil’s World Cup Squad

Selection hinges on full physical readiness.

Overview

  • Carlo Ancelotti, speaking Monday to L’Equipe, said Neymar must show he can reach 100% within about two months to be considered for Brazil’s World Cup roster.
  • Ancelotti restated that he will pick only players who are physically ready, signaling that past achievements will not secure a call-up.
  • Neymar had knee surgery on December 22 and underwent another procedure this month, then played the full 90 minutes for Santos in Saturday’s 1-0 win over Atletico Mineiro.
  • The forward has been left out of every Brazil squad since Ancelotti took charge in June and has not played for the national team since October 2023.
  • Fan support and mixed views continue, with chants for Neymar during the loss to France and a neutral take from ex-teammate Hulk, while Brazil also evaluates younger attacking options.
